This Is What It Feels Like
Lost in my imagination I can visualize the vibrations resonating from my core. Why have I fought this for so long? Sending me signs hidden in songs, every line, lyric, and rhyme. I remember almost feeling this way, once when I was misinformed. I don't want to go another step without you. The loose, ecstatic energy, manifesting, lingering, becoming one. It feels like the weight of the world has descended into two atmospheres -- Earth; holds everyone's seasons, sing me a reason in my next life, why I wouldn't glide through the forest like deer.
